  7. Keep driving, go to Baker. It's in great shape still. I skied the Coleman-Deming on Saturday (9/15). 4700' vertical of decent corn, ~2.5 miles of hiking in on good trail. Waaay better environs than da Hood this time of year. It's always ski season in WA bishes! Yeah, I could do that too... But that is a WAAAY longer drive... Hood, while sucky, is only 45 min. away.
